Roland H. Nichols

NicholsRGraveside services for Roland H. Nichols will be Saturday April 3, 2010 at 2:00 P.M. at the Eastlawn Memorial Park in Early Texas. Visitation will be Friday April 2, 2010 from 6 to 7:00 PM at the Heartland Funeral Home in Early, Texas.

Mr. Nichols passed away Wednesday at his home in Early, Texas.  He was born  August 17, 1928 to Vernon and Inez Deavers Nichols in Winchell, Texas.

Roland was married to Mary Nelms on May 23, 1949 in Brownwood, Texas, he worked for Santa Fe Railroad as a brakeman and a conductor for 41 years.  He served his country in the United States Air Force for a number of years.  Roland was a lifetime member of the Brownwood VFW and a member of the Cattlemen’s Association.  He was also a member of the Elks Club.

Roland is survived by his wife Mary Nelms Nichols of Early, Texas, three daughters Patsy and husband Bill Biggs of Temple, Texas, Paula Young and finance Jess Kennedy of Early, Texas, and Susan Nix of Whitney, Texas.  He is also survived by his two sons Larry and wife Kay Nichols of Mountain Home, Texas and Stephen Nichols and finance Jana Quick of Brownwood, Texas.  Roland is survived by 10 grandchildren and 10 Great-grandchildren, one brother Wayne Nichols of Brownwood and one sister Jean and husband Jim Perkins of Lake Brownwood, Tx.

He was preceded in death by a daughter Donna Lockett, his parents, one brother and two sisters.

Friends and relatives may sign his online guest book at heartlandfuneralhome.net

Heartland Funeral Home of Early is in charge of arrangements.
